Dhaka, 23 January 2026 – The Dhaka Metropolitan Police’s Detective Branch has successfully apprehended Rahim, the alleged gunman responsible for the murder of Md. Azizur Rahman Musabbir, former General Secretary of the Volunteer Party’s Dhaka North unit. Authorities recovered two firearms during the operation.
Rahim was arrested early on Friday morning from Narsingdi district, while another suspect, Md. Billal, had previously been detained and taken into remand for questioning.
The murder occurred on 7 January in the Tejgaon area of Dhaka. On that evening, Musabbir was socialising with friends near the West Tezturi Market, close to Tejgaon Police Station. After the gathering, he set off for home at approximately 8:00 pm. Just ten minutes later, a group of four to five unidentified assailants intercepted him near the Ahsanullah Institute in Tezturi Market and opened fire. Musabbir was struck by multiple bullets and fell to the ground.
Sufian Bepari Masud, who was accompanying Musabbir, attempted to intervene and protect him but was also shot by the assailants. Following the attack, the perpetrators fled the scene. Bystanders immediately transported Musabbir and Masud to a nearby hospital. Unfortunately, Musabbir was pronounced dead by the attending physician. Masud was subsequently admitted to Dhaka Medical College Hospital for treatment and is currently receiving care.
In response to the killing, Musabbir’s wife, Suraiya Begum, 42, filed a formal murder complaint at Tejgaon Police Station on the same day, 7 January. Law enforcement authorities have launched a full-scale investigation to identify and apprehend any remaining suspects involved in the attack.
